Nurpur Rajputan
Nurpur Rajputan is a village in Kapurthala district of Punjab State, India. It is located 9 kilometres from Kapurthala, which is both district and sub-district headquarters of Nurpur Rajputan.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Kapurthala is a city in Punjab state of India. It is the administrative headquarters of Kapurthala District. It was the capital of the Kapurthala State, a princely state in British India.
